Boynton Beach, FL

Palm Beach County

Some Restrictions

STR guests pay 6% FL sales tax, 1% Palm Beach County discretionary surtax, and 7% Palm Beach County Tourist Development Tax for a total of 14% on stays of 6 months or less.

Boca Raton FAQ

What taxes do STR operators pay in Boca Raton?

Operators must collect Palm Beach County tourist development tax and Florida state sales tax on short-term rental income from stays under six months.

Where do I register for STR taxes in Boca Raton?

Register with the Palm Beach County Tax Collector for the tourist development tax and the Florida Department of Revenue for state sales tax.
